Hearty Beef Macaroni Casserole

A comforting and cheesy Beef Macaroni Casserole, packed with savory ground beef, a rich tomato sauce, and tender macaroni, all baked to golden-brown perfection. A family-friendly classic perfect for any weeknight dinner.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 5 minutes
Servings: 8 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 585

Ingredients
  

For the Casserole
  • 1 lb Elbow Macaroni (16 oz)
  • 1 tbsp Olive Oil
  • 1.5 lbs Lean Ground Beef 85/15 or 90/10 recommended
  • 1 large Yellow Onion finely chopped
  • 3 cloves Garlic minced
  • 1 can Crushed Tomatoes (28 oz)
  • 1 can Tomato Sauce (8 oz)
  • 1/2 cup Beef Broth low-sodium
  • 1 tbsp Worcestershire Sauce
  • 1 tsp Dried Oregano
  • 1 tsp Dried Basil
  • 1 tsp Salt or to taste
  • 1/2 tsp Black Pepper freshly ground
  • 2 cups Shredded Sharp Cheddar Cheese divided
  • 1 cup Shredded Mozzarella Cheese

Equipment

  • 9x13 inch Casserole Dish
  • Large Skillet or Dutch Oven
  • Large pot
  • Colander

Method
 

Preparation
  •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9x13-inch casserole dish.
  • Cook the elbow macaroni in a large pot of salted boiling water according to package directions until al dente. Drain well using a colander and set aside.
Make the Beef Sauce
  • While the macaroni is cooking, heat the olive oil in a large skillet or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add the ground beef and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ned, about 5-7 minutes. Drain off any excess grease.
  • Add the chopped onion to the skillet with the beef and cook until softened, about 4-5 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.
  • Stir in the crushed tomatoes, tomato sauce, beef broth, Worcestershire sauce, dried oregano, dried basil, salt, and pepper. Bring the mixture to a simmer, then reduce the he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for 15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
Assemble and Bake
  • Remove the sauce from the heat. Add the cooked macaroni, 1 cup of the shredded cheddar cheese, and all of the shredded mozzarella cheese to the skillet with the beef sauce. Stir gently until everything is well combined.
  • Pour the macaroni and beef mixture into the prepared casserole dish and spread it into an even layer.
  • Sprinkle the remaining 1 cup of sh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the top.
  • Bake, uncovered, for 25-30 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ly and the edges are golden brown.
  • Let the casserole rest for 10 minutes before serving. This allows it to set and makes it easier to serve.

Notes

For extra veggies, add 1 cup of diced bell peppers or mushrooms when you sauté the onions. You can substitute the ground beef with ground turkey for a lighter version. This casserole can be assembled up to 24 hours in advance; cover and refrigerate before baking (you may need to add 5-10 minutes to the baking time).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

My Tips for the Perfect Outcome

  • Al Dente Pasta: Cook macaroni a minute less than package directions; it finishes baking in the sauce.
  • Grate Your Own Cheese: Freshly grated cheese melts creamier than pre-shredded bags.
  • Rest Before Serving: Let the casserole sit for 5-10 minutes before cutting to help it set.

Can I prepare this casserole 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can assemble the entire casserole without baking it, then cover and refrigerate it for up to 24 hours. When you’re ready to eat, you may need to add about 10-15 minutes to the baking time since it will be going into the oven cold. It’s a great time-saver for busy evenings.

What’s the best ground beef to use?

I prefer using lean ground beef, like 90/10 or 85/15. This provides plenty of rich flavor for the Beef Macaroni Casserole without making the final dish overly greasy. If you only have beef with a higher fat content, just be sure to drain off any excess grease after browning it.

Can I use a different type of pasta?

Yes, you certainly can. While elbow macaroni is classic for this dish, other short pasta shapes like rotini, penne, or shells work wonderfully. They are all great at catching the delicious beefy sauce. Just be sure to cook whichever pasta you choose to al dente before adding it to the casserole.

Is this Beef Macaroni Casserole freezer-friendly?

This recipe freezes beautifully! I recommend baking it in a freezer-safe dish and letting it cool completely. Cover it tightly with a layer of plastic wrap and then foil. It can be frozen for up to three months. To reheat,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and bake until hot and bubbly.
